The Focus Fusion Society (FFS), a non-profit organization devoted to advancing research into fusion with hydrogen-boron fuel and the

dense plasma focus device, has granted LPPFusion an additional $81,000 for further research, extending a grant previously made. The funds for this new grant came mainly from a donation to FFS by the Whitefish Community Foundation. These funds will be used in completing the switch tests and making the final-design switches that emerge from the tests. Thanks to all who made this possible!

Together with the $245,000 in investments raised so far on Wefunder, this new grant brings LPPFusion’s total cash inflow in the second half of 2022 to $326,000.
